Canillo, a picturesque parish in Andorra, offers a range of activities and attractions for visitors. One of the main highlights is the Grandvalira Ski Resort, which is known for its extensive ski slopes and diverse winter sports options. During the winter months, skiing and snowboarding attract many enthusiasts, while in the summer, the area transforms into a hub for hiking and mountain biking.
Another notable site is the Sant Joan de Caselles Church, a beautiful Romanesque church that dates back to the 11th century. Its architecture and historical significance make it a worthwhile stop for those interested in culture and history. Additionally, the Mirador del Roc del Quer provides stunning pan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and valleys, offering a serene spot for photography and contemplation.
For those looking to relax, the Naturlandia Adventure Park offers various outdoor activities suitable for families, including toboggan rides and treetop adventures. The park emphasizes the natural beauty of the region and promotes outdoor recreation.
In terms of local culture, visitors can explore the Canillo Museum, which showcases the history and traditions of the area. Engaging with local cuisine is also recommended, with several restaurants serving traditional Andorran dishes that reflect the region's culinary heritage.
Overall, Canillo provides a blend of outdoor adventure, cultural experiences, and opportunities for relaxation, making it an appealing destination for a variety of travelers.
